PRAYER: Writ Petition fil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, for issuance of Writ of Certiorarified Mandamus, calling for the records in pursuant to the impugned Charge Memo issued by the 4th respondent in proceeding Na.Ka.9791/2001/A4 dated 17.08.2001 and quash the same and consequently direct the respondents to settle all the pensionary benefits including arrears of pension and other consequential monetary and service benefits with 9% interest. ORDER
The writ petition is filed challenging the charge memo dated 17.08.2001.
2. There is no appearance on behalf of the petitioner.
3. Learned counsel appearing for the sixth respondent submits that the matter has become infructuous.
2/4
4. Accordingly, this writ petition is dismissed as having become infructuous. No costs. Connected miscellaneous petitions are closed. 26.02.2024 Index: Yes Speaking Order: No mp To
